On 17.2.2012, at 11.51, joshua@hybrid.pl wrote:
By the way: what might have caused such a warning?
root@mail2.hybrid.pl /tmp/transfer> doveadm quota recalc -u joshua@hybrid.pl doveadm(joshua@hybrid.pl): Warning: Created dotlock file's timestamp is different than current time (1329464622 vs 1329464672): /var/mail/mail/hybrid.pl/joshua/.mailing.ekg/dovecot-uidlist Does it keep happening? Is this a local filesystem or NFS? Shouldn't happen unless remote storage server's clock and local server's clock aren't synced.
